Hola de Espana!
Things are really rocking now and we are more than half-way through
mixing "The Last Dance"! The song order is settled and
several interesting things are falling into place. Each song has
developed its own "personality" now and they are neatly
tied together by a couple of common "threads". I have
to say that Dani's engineering and incredible attention to detail
have a lot to do with the results plus the fact that he persuaded
me to open my mind to some different thinking right from the beginning!
And I am really happy he did too! The heaviest song on the record
("Letting Go") has a nice acoustic guitar arpeggio in
the verses.... something I would have thought impossible but it
works! We have used different voices on the backing vocals too and
that helps to create a lot of different colours. For the most part
it's how we did it in Heep but, since then, I have mostly just tracked
my own voice. I am liking this change a lot! There are many sounds
that you may find hard to identify and which are not at all dominant
but which really add a lot to the tracks.
We will finalise the cover early next week and soon after that the
"limited edition" copies will be ready. We can only offer
500 because of my contract so be sure and grab one!!
The CD will be released in Russia on September 18th
(with a different cover) but it won't be released anywhere else
until the end of October so I will soon be caught up in the planning
for touring and promotion but I am really looking forward to all
of this! Now I am going to take the weekend off to celebrate my
birthday with a few friends and then we'll be back here on Monday
to finish up!! I'll keep you all posted from now throught the mastering.
I am anxious to share this with you so stay tuned!
